My Mom's in Pain-A Poem by my son
My Mom's in pain most all the time,
Just as sure as this poem does Rhyme.
though, alot she may not wail;
her love for us will never fail!
In the Lord we all do trust,
the Lord will not forsake his love for us.
My Mom spends most of her time in pain,
but, she trusts the Lord all the same.
She moves around the world by chair,
of this, I do not think is fair.
Her body hurts more than all your pain,
Her legs feel like they are aflame.
You cannot touch her legs at all,
then they hurt her most of all.
By:
Vincent Anderson
age; 13
